Steps to Obtain a Driver's License
The procedure normally includes a number of actions, which may differ depending on local policies and the type of driver's license sought. Below are the basic actions one might follow:
1. Determine Eligibility
Before embarking on the journey to get a driver's license, individuals ought to first determine their eligibility based upon several requirements, which may include:
Age Requirement: Most places have a minimum age requirement, often varying from 16 to 18.Residency: Applicants need to be homeowners of the state or region where they are using.Legal Status: Ensure all paperwork abides by regional laws.2. Total a Driver's Education Course
Numerous states need brand-new drivers to complete a driver's education course, especially for those under the age of 18. These courses usually cover the following:
Traffic laws and regulationsDefensive driving techniquesRisk acknowledgment3. Obtain a Learner's Permit
When the educational requirements are fulfilled, a candidate can make an application for a student's authorization. This permits monitored driving while practicing abilities. The steps to get a learner's permit usually consist of:
Submitting an applicationPassing a written knowledge testPaying appropriate fees4. Practice Driving

5. Schedule a Driving Test
After fulfilling the practice requirements, individuals can set up a driving test. The driving test usually consists of:
A vehicle safety examination, validating that the car is roadworthyManeuvers such as turning, parallel parking, and obeying traffic signalsA demonstration of protective driving methods6. Get the Driver's License
Upon effectively passing the driving test, applicants can get their driver's license. The requirements for acquiring the license might include:
Submission of necessary files (proof of identity, residency, etc)Payment of licensing costsIssuance of a provisionary or complete license depending on age and driving experience7. Familiarize Yourself with Driving Regulations
Having obtained a driver's license, it's vital to stay informed about local driving laws, guidelines, and any changes that might occur. Awareness of laws relating to speeding, driving under the impact, and seatbelt usage can avoid future legal concerns.
Documents Required to Obtain a Driver's License
The documents required throughout the application procedure can differ by area, but generally includes:
Proof of Identity: This might consist of a birth certificate, passport, or social security card.Proof of Residency: Documents like utility bills or bank declarations revealing the applicant's name and address.Conclusion Certificate: Proof of completion for a driver's education course, if appropriate.Student's Permit: If the applicant is transitioning from a learner's permit.Common FAQs
1. For how long is a driver's license legitimate?

The validity duration for a driver's license varies by jurisdiction. In numerous areas, licenses should be renewed every 4 to eight years. Check local regulations for specific details.

2. What should I do if I fail the driving test?

If you fail the driving test, remain calm. Each state normally permits retaking the examination after a set waiting duration. Use the time to practice and reinforce your abilities.

3. Can I drive with a learner's license?

Yes, however just when accompanied by a licensed grownup who meets specific requirements, such as being over a specific age and having a valid driver's license.

4. Exist additional requirements for business licenses?

Yes, individuals looking for a commercial driver's license (CDL) need to undergo additional training and testing particular to the kind of vehicle they plan to operate, consisting of specific medical requirements.

5. What are the limitations on a provisional license?

Provisional licenses frequently feature particular constraints, such as limits on nighttime driving or carrying travelers. Familiarize yourself with these rules to avoid charges.

6. How can I prepare for the written knowledge test?

To get ready for the composed knowledge test, study your state's driver handbook, take practice quizzes offered through different online platforms, and think about registering in a driver's education course if you have not done so currently.
